    Just done the most painful but physically rewarding PT session I've ever done tonight.

    On tuesday I jarred my back slightly but it made every movement painful. My PT helped me with a little physio before the session and tailored it to my injury, but god damn it was difficult.

    Session consisted of:

    2000m rowing with 20s full power, 10s rest interval training on a hard setting.

    Shuttle runs in a boxing ring from corner to corner in a Z pattern, 30s on, 10s rest. 5 sets, then a further 3 after a 2 minute break.The floor (being cushioned) helped the injury as it was low impact but still felt it.

    Stretches on the pullup bar to help stretch out the affected muscles.

    It was a well managed session but I'm feeling it. Resting tonight and tomorrow before going back to bootcamp on Saturday morning for high intensity cardio.

    Weight this morning was 248.3 lbs, so lost 3 lbs since Tuesday and I suspect after tonight there will be a result at tomorrow's weigh in.

    Happy days.

    Weighed in this morning at 246.8, which brings my total weight loss since I started on Tuesday to 5lbs. Five days, five pounds. I'm reasonably happy with a pound a day off the body as that will put me at a half stone off at the end of the week. Assuming that kind of steady rate, I can predict perhaps 35 lbs off by June 19th, which is 7 more than target.

    I didn't make it to bootcamp this morning but did manage to just finish a makeshift PT session off my own back at the gym. Whilst I'm sure I burned a few calories, it wasn't as intense as my PT with Jack and I feel I went too easy on myself. It's hard to be motivated to push that extra mile or do that extra set when you don't have a six foot monster screaming encouragement at you, but at least I got out and did something.

    Consisting of:

    6 sets of 20s on, 10s off high intensity rowing
    10x 15kg Kettlebell "shotput" lift on each arm
    20 ball slams
    20 situps
    3 sets of 30kg bench press at 5 reps per set
    10 leg curls at 15kg
    10 mins cooldown on bike

    It looks a lot but it isn't, especially as I wasn't putting the same level of intensity in as I would with Jack. However, I at least did something and my next hour of exercise is an hour of football on Monday night before I hit PT again on Tuesday.

    Food wise, I have been sticking to an extremely strict diet. An example is today's catering: Breakfast is greek yoghurt with oats (protein and carbs), with mushrooms. Lunch tends to be 185g of rice (carbs), a seasoned chicken breast (protein) and mixed peppers and mushrooms. Dinner is cod (protein), green beans and 60g of mixed almonds and pistaccios for the fat I need. No carbs at all after 1pm and I genuinely feel amazing for it, although I do suffer sugar withdrawal like a heroin addict. Last night at 9pm I was shaking like a fucking leaf!
